Dental implants are the most realistic and effective dental substitutions. They are the perfect solution for patients who have suffered the trauma of a knocked out tooth or a tooth lost to infection, who still retain a strong jawbone.

Missing teeth can be very embarrassing and also the source of dental health complications such as misaligned teeth and excessive bacteria build up. It is therefore very important to try and replace missing teeth as soon as possible with a dental restoration. There are a number of these available, including dental bridges and partial dentures. It is the dental implant however, that provides the most solid and lifelike alternative to a real tooth.

The implant itself comes in the shape of a small titanium screw. This is drilled into the jawbone in a process that sounds a lot more unpleasant than it actually is. It is then left to fuse with the surrounding tissue in a process called osseointergration. Once this has bonded, it can then be used as a base for a post and artificial crown. In this way, a dental implant replaces the whole of the tooth from top to bottom, unlike every other dental restoration.

Dental implants are permanent and less likely to suffer damage than other more temporary replacements. They should be treated and cleaned exactly like normal teeth in order to preserve their functionality. It is also possible to have a series of smaller implants fitted to act as a base for a set of dentures. By clipping dentures to mini-implants you can alleviate the annoyance and anxiety of loose dentures or dentures prone to falling out.
